Huawei announced one of the most interesting products of recent years, at the end of last year, a smartwatch that is also a charging case and inside it has a pair of TWS headphones. WATCH Buds was launched in China and is now preparing to debut in global markets.
The Chinese company confirmed the launch by starting pre-orders in the UK and announcing general sales for March 1st. The price of the smartwatch is £449.99 or around 511 euros. At the moment, the markets in which the smart watch will be released and the prices it will have in them remain unknown.
The Huawei WATCH Buds has a 1.43-inch AMOLED circular screen with 460 x 460 pixels resolution, a leather strap, and a crown. It tracks heart rate, sleep, blood oxygen levels, and 80 sports activities. The headphones have a pill-shaped design and can be worn on both ears, while they have touch controls.
